Transaction cc205fe19a6f1038566a68c0211d6386322e10335a301e6028cec21b7ba75a95
1 Input
1 Output
-
cc205fe19a6f1038566a68c0211d6386322e10335a301e6028cec21b7ba75a95:0
- value
- 363929
- script pubkey
- OP_0 OP_PUSHBYTES_20 0417c507897809716f971cb622fad101a8d29c8e
- address
- bc1qqstu2puf0qyhzmuhrjmz97k3qx5d98ywjxy5e5